Anthony Gose drove in five runs Saturday, powering the Toronto Blue Jays to a 9-2, rain-delayed victory over Boston. Gose's two-run single highlighted a five-run second inning that broke the game open for the Blue Jays, who clinched their three-game series. Toronto outfielder added a three-run homer in the ninth to cap the scoring after the contest had been delayed twice by rain. Yunel Escobar also went deep to aid Toronto's victory. Brad Lincoln (1-0) was credited with the win after the delays interrupted starter Aaron Laffey, who had allowed two runs on four hits over 4 2/3 innings. Red Sox starter Daisuke Matsuzaka (1-5) was pounded for five runs on five hits while lasting just 1 1/3 innings. Pedro Ciriaco and Scott Podsednik drove in runs for the Bosox.
